Get in Touch** The Hyundai repair market in Rochester, Indiana, itself is characteristic of a smaller, rural city. There are no dedicated Hyundai specialty shops or dealerships within the city limits. The local market is served by competent general repair shops, with **K&R Automotive** being the clear standout for routine and semi-complex Hyundai maintenance and repairs. For specialized services—especially those requiring factory certification like **Theta II engine warranty work, ADAS recalibration, and hybrid/electric vehicle systems**—residents must travel to authorized dealerships in larger neighboring cities like **Kokomo (O'Daniel Hyundai)** or **Fort Wayne (Graham Hyundai)**. This creates a two-tier market: local shops for general upkeep and regional dealerships for factory-mandated procedures. Independent expertise for complex mechanical issues (e.g., persistent turbo or DCT problems) is also found outside Rochester, with shops like **Import Specialists** in Fort Wayne filling that niche. Pricing reflects this structure: local independent shops (e.g., K&R) offer the most competitive labor rates, regional specialists (e.g., Import Specialists) charge a premium for advanced expertise, and dealerships (e.g., O'Daniel) command the highest prices for OEM parts and certified technician labor. The competition for specialized Hyundai work is therefore regional, not local, requiring Rochester customers to evaluate providers based on the specific nature of their repair needs.

In Rochester, common issues include problems with the Theta II engine (found in models like the Sonata and Santa Fe) which can lead to excessive oil consumption or knocking, especially given our local temperature fluctuations. Also, due to our rural roads and winter road treatments, suspension components and brake corrosion are frequent service items for local Hyundai owners.
Look for a shop with ASE-certified technicians who have specific training or experience with Hyundai models, as general mechanics may not have the latest software for complex diagnostics. In the Rochester area, checking for strong local reviews and asking if they use genuine Hyundai or OEM parts is a good indicator of a quality, specialized service provider.
Labor rates at independent shops in Rochester are typically more competitive than dealerships in cities like Fort Wayne or South Bend, potentially saving you money. However, for major warranty or recall work, such as the engine recalls affecting many Hyundais, you may need to visit the nearest authorized dealership, which could involve travel.
For routine maintenance (oil changes, brakes, tires) and most non-warranty repairs, a trusted local Rochester shop is convenient and cost-effective. You should visit an authorized dealership for warranty-covered repairs, specific software updates, or complex recall campaigns that require specialized factory tools and certification.
Our Northern Indiana winters with salt and brine on the roads make undercarriage washes crucial to prevent rust and more frequent brake inspections advisable. Additionally, the prevalence of potholes in spring can accelerate wear on tires, alignments, and suspension components, so having these checked locally after winter is highly recommended.
